- 博客(4)
- 收藏
- 关注
原创 比较三个数a,b,c的大小并从小到大排序
#include <stdio.h>int main(){ int a=3,b=3,c=3,buf; if(a>b) { if(a>c) { buf=a; a=c; c=buf; if(a>b) { buf=a; a=b; b=buf; } printf("%d%d%d\n",a,b,c); } else { buf=a; a=b; b=buf; print
2020-08-26 16:25:46 2300
原创 C++的引用用法
C++的引用用法C++中的引用其实就是变量名的一个别名,比如说定义一个整型变量a,int a,这时候则可以给变量名a去一个别名,格式为:int a;int& b=a;//这句话的含义是a是一个初始化定义为b的整型引用引用常用在函数的形参中和函数的返回值1.引用用在函数的形参中://两个变量之间的值相互交换#include <iostream>using namespace std;int swap(int&,int&);int main(){ i
2020-08-21 18:29:59 282
原创 关于C++中srand((unsigned)time(NULL))的理解
关于C++中srand((unsigned)time(NULL))的理解srand((unsigned)time(NULL))是经常和rand()函数搭配在一起,在平时的编程中,可能我们只用rand()函数就能够满足得到随机数的需求,但实际上,计算机产生的是伪随机数,伪随机数是计算机中已经编好的无规则排序的数字,它们的排序是没有规律的,并将它们平均分成N份,rand函数只是从这里面的数字中随机抽取一个,所以是有可能获得的随机数是重复的。函数原型是void srand(unsigned seed),这里的
2020-08-21 10:03:44 7136
原创 浅谈C/C++中交换数值的函数方法
浅谈C/C++中交换数值的函数方法学习C++的过程中遇到过很多坑,其中有一个坑就是交换变量的值。通过网上的学习,总结出来几个常用的方法。1.不封装函数,直接在main函数中实现交换。#include <iostream>using namespace std;int main(){ int a=1,b=2,c; c=a; a=b; b=c; cout<<a<<" "<<b<<endl; return 0;}输出结果:
2020-08-20 18:37:19 1688
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人